PT-2022-19922 · Unknown · Librehealth Emr

Manfromkz

·

Published

2022-05-05

·

Updated

2022-05-12

·

CVE-2022-29938

CVSS v3.1

8.8

High

VectorAV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
Name of the Vulnerable Software and Affected Versions LibreHealth EHR version 2.0.0
Description The issue is related to a lack of sanitization of the payment id parameter in the interfacebilling ew payment.php file via interfacebillingpayment master.inc.php, which leads to SQL injection.
Recommendations For LibreHealth EHR version 2.0.0, consider disabling access to the interfacebilling ew payment.php file until a patch is available to prevent SQL injection via the payment id parameter. Restrict access to the interfacebillingpayment master.inc.php file to minimize the risk of exploitation. Avoid using the payment id parameter in the affected API endpoint until the issue is resolved. At the moment, there is no information about a newer version that contains a fix for this vulnerability.

Exploit

SQL injection

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

CVE-2022-29938

Affected Products

Librehealth Emr